13 Force for 100 What is force? AA – a loud sound BB – a push or pull CC – a long day DD – a object

14 Motion For 100 What is motion? AA –change of position or location; movement BB –change of address CC –change of name DD –change of something with wings

15 Weight & Gravity For 100 Your weight equals your? AA –mass. BB –mass divided by the net force acting on you. CC –mass times acceleration due to gravity. DD –mass times your speed.

16 Chemistry For 100 According to the Law of Conservation of Mass, how does the mass of the products in a chemical reaction compare to the mass of the reactants? AA –there is no relationship. BB –the mass of products is sometimes greater. CC –the mass of reactants is greater. DD –the masses are always equal.

17 Force For 100 Newton created 3 Laws of Motion. The 1 st Law of Motion tells us that if an object is at rest it will stay at rest, and if an object is in motion, it will____________. AA –stay in motion unless acted on by force BB –stay in motion but slow down CC –stop eventually DD –speed up

18 Force For 200 Which of the following relationships is correct? AA 1N = 1kg B B 1N = 1kg x m CC 1N = 1kg x m/s D D 1N = 1kg x m/s 2

19 Motion For 200 The difference between speed & velocity is that velocity includes? AA –distance. B B –time. CC –weight. D D –direction.

20 Weight & Gravity For 200 The acceleration due to gravity on the surface of Mars is about one-third the acceleration due to gravity on Earth’s surface. The weight of Spud on the surface of Mars is about? AA –nine times greater than its weight on Earth’s surface. B B –three times greater than its weight on Earth’s surface CC –one-third its weight on Earth’s surface. D D –the same as its weight on Earth’s surface.

21 Chemistry For 200 Which statement best explains why atoms form chemical bonds with other atoms? AA –most atoms are less stable when they combine with other atoms. B B –when atoms collide with other atoms, they bond automatically. CC –atoms are always attracted to other atoms. D D –most atoms are unstable unless they are combined with other atoms.

22 Force For 200 The forces acting on a falling leaf are? AA –air resistance and fluid friction. B B –gravity and fluid friction. CC –gravity and static friction. D D –weight and rolling friction.

23 Force For 300 Spud kicks a door with a force of 100 N, and the door swings open. What is the force exerted on Spud’s foot by the door? AA –10 N, because the door swings open. B B –100 N in the opposite direction. CC – Larger because the door is solid. D D – Doors cannot produce forces.

24 Motion For 300 In order to determine speed, you must know? AA –time B B –distance CC – Both (a) & (b) D D –none of the above

25 Weight & Gravity For 300 Projectile motion is caused by? AA –the downward force of friction. B B –an initial forward velocity. CC –a final vertical velocity. D D –the downward force of gravity & an initial forward velocity.

26 Chemistry For 300 When an atom gains or loses electrons, it has an electrical charge. It is known as? AA –a free radical. B B –an ion. CC –a hydrate. D D –a monoatomic molecule.

27 Force For 300 A force’s mass and ______ can be multiplied to find force applied to an object. AA –speed B B –distance CC –acceleration D D –weight

28 Force For 400 What is the net force acting on a soccer ball if the ball has a mass of 2.0 kg and has an acceleration of 18.9 m/s 2 ? AA –12.6 N B B –0.08 N CC –37.8 N D D –9.45 N

29 Motion For 400 A person walks 1000m everyday for exercise, leaving her front porch at 9:00 a.m. and returning to her front porch at 9:25 a.m. What is the total displacement of her daily walk? AA 1000m B B 0m CC 25 minutes D D none of the above.

30 Weight & Gravity For 400 Four objects were dropped at the same time from the same height. Which object will most likely have the longest drop time? AA –an iron ball B B –an open umbrella CC –a horseshoe magnet D D –a large book

31 Chemistry For 400 In the chemical equation, 2HCl + Ca(OH) 2  CaCl 2 + 2H 2 0, the number of atoms of reactants is? AA – 2 B B – 3 CC – 5 D D – 9

32 Force For 400 “Forces occur in pairs” is another way of stating Newton’s? AA –First Law of Motion B B –Second Law of Motion CC –Third Law of Motion DD– Universal Law of Motion.

33 Force For 500 As the mass of an object is increased, what happens to its inertia? AA –It increases. B B –It decreases. CC –It stays the same. D D –Inertia & mass are not related in any way.

34 Motion For 500 Spin a raw egg on the table, stop it with your hand, and remove your hand quickly. The egg will begin to spin again with no help at all describes Newton’s? AA –First Law of Motion B B –Second Law of Motion CC –Third Law of Motion D D –Universal Law of Motion

35 Weight & Gravity For 500 Without any air resistance, a golf ball falls into a well, its acceleration due to gravity? AA –remains constant. B B –increases. CC –decreases. D D –changes.

36 Chemistry For 500 Mg atom becomes an ion, Mg+2, when it? AA –gains 2 electrons. B B –loses 2 electrons. CC –gains 2 protons. D D –loses 2 protons.

37 Force For 500 There are 3 objects, a golf ball, a tennis ball, and a bowling ball. Which of these will accelerate faster towards Earth? Assuming that air friction is not counted for. AA –the golf ball. B B –the tennis ball. CC –the bowling ball. D D –all the same.
